What is the online signature legitimacy for organizations in Mexico

The online signature legitimacy for organizations in Mexico refers to the legal recognition of electronic signatures as valid and enforceable. This legitimacy is crucial for businesses that operate in a digital environment, as it ensures that signed documents hold the same weight as traditional handwritten signatures. In Mexico, the legal framework supporting electronic signatures includes the Federal Civil Code and the Electronic Signature Law, which outline the requirements for a signature to be considered valid.

Legal use of the online signature legitimacy for organizations in Mexico

The legal use of online signatures in Mexico is governed by specific laws that outline how electronic signatures must be executed to be deemed valid. Organizations must ensure that their eSignature practices meet these legal requirements, including the use of secure authentication methods and maintaining a clear audit trail of the signing process. This legal framework protects both the organization and the signers, ensuring that agreements are enforceable in court.

Security & Compliance Guidelines

Security and compliance are critical when using online signatures in Mexico. Organizations should implement robust security measures, such as encryption and secure access controls, to protect sensitive information. Compliance with legal standards requires maintaining detailed records of the signing process, including timestamps and IP addresses of signers. Regular audits and updates to security protocols can help organizations stay compliant with evolving regulations.
